The Key Sabian Symbols
at the Concordance Moment
John Mirehiel

Although almost all astrologers are aware of the Sabian Symbols, their use in general practice seems to have waned in recent years.  With the advent of the ubiquitous computer, an armada of newer techniques has arrived, and the Sabians now rest in so many dust covered corners while 90° dials, the asteroid Goddesses, Astro-Cartography, Trans-Neptunians, Campanus Mundoscopes, etc. have come to the fore (and perhaps rightly so; there is Truth to be found in each and every one of those applications).  The astrological news groups rarely mention the Sabians, professional journals to which I subscribe seem to have given them short shrift, and if you are new to astrology, there is little that would recommend you to them among the generally available titles offered in bookstores.  Nevertheless, there remains for me something of a magical quality to the Sabians Symbols, in both their ideas and imagery, which I think transcends the numbers crunching and whiz-bang technology now so commonly available.  Perhaps it is because of this quality that it occurred to me to apply the Sabians to the "magical" moment of the Harmonic Concordance.

I myself was first introduced to the Sabian Symbols in 1969, nearly a full year before I had had my first astrological encounter.  It came by the way of a science fiction novel entitled Macroscope, by Piers Anthony.   In it, the main antagonist has hidden himself "inside" the hero.  But by clever means, of course, the Sabian Symbols are applied to the hero’s astrological chart to reveal the bad guy’s ruse.  The book was fascinating, and indeed led me to read several of Anthony’s other works.  But the enduring effect on me was that of the Sabians.

The Sabian Symbols were largely the work of the late Marc Edmund Jones.  Jones took his cue from the work on the symbolic meaning of the degrees of the Welsh seer, John Thomas (AKA Charubel).  While Jones appreciated Thomas’ work and felt that it was remarkably suggestive, he also thought it to be too moralistic in tone.  Seeking to "soften" Thomas’ symbolism, he proceeded to create his own set of symbols which might be more relevant to contemporary students of astrology.   To this end he enlisted Elise Wheeler, one of his students, who, because of her innate talent, he had encouraged to become a professional medium.  Jones had Elsie describe the "picture" that  came to her as he held a randomly selected index card, upon which he had penciled one of the 360 degrees of the Zodiac.  In this way, the original impressionistic images, each symbolically suggesting a characteristic of one specific degree, were compiled in a day’s effort.  Jones' Symbolic Astrology was first published in 1931 and it is upon that seminal work that all subsequent commentary on the Sabians has been based.

During the course of the years, others have added to the depth of meaning found in the original images.  Chief among these annotators was Dane Rudhyar who had found that the Sabians were "…in the main, amazingly significant and accurate."  In agreement with Jones, Rudhyar carefully analyzed each of the original images, adding a "keynote" phrase and an explanatory comment, which fleshed out Jones’ original terse, symbolic aphorisms. Rudhyar’s explication of the Sabians first appeared in his monumental classic, The Astrology of Personality.   Some 17 years later his updated work on the symbols was published in An Astrological Mandala By then, he had come to consider them to be a contemporary American embodiment of the I Ching, and suggested that they had oracular properties.  It is from that latter work that the paragraphs below are drawn.

Perhaps the best known contemporary interpreter of the Sabians is the Australian astrologer Lynda Hill.  Her work draws on Jones’ text as well as his original mimeographed lessons as well as Rudhyar’s volumes.  Her own text, The Sabian Symbols As An Oracle, is widely known and respected.   Lynda's web site provides a free oracle reading, articles and news, an open forum, a message board and a Weblog .  She has graciously given us permission to excerpt her text for this article. Another web site dedicated to the Sabians, and which might also be of interest, can be found at www.sabian.org.   It also has a wealth of information on the history of the Sabians, an excellent short bio of Jones, and an oracular link to the symbols, among other features.

Why the symbols seem to work and fit appropriately into the scheme of an astrological chart is, perhaps, a mystery.   The fact is, though, that they do work in practice, and I regularly apply them in the interpretations that I do as a professional astrologer.   The insights that they provide often have given me a quick read on the general proclivity of a client’s life, and in so doing have allowed me to arrive at an overall "feeling tone" for a client.  More importantly, they can be very helpful in guiding clients to the expression of the best qualities of their planets through their Sabian degree associations.

In the chart for the Harmonic Concordance, just as with the chart for any given day, there are literally dozens of points and planets to which the Sabians could be applied.  In this case, however, I will simplify matters considerably by working only with the six planets that comprise the Grand Sextile.  Moving clockwise from the Sun, those planets are Jupiter, Saturn, the Moon, Mars, and Chiron.  The "feeling tone" that emerges from these six points is but further confirmation of the message, importance, and "instructions" that the Harmonic Concordance provides.

Without any additional comments from me, I present the interpretations of the significant degrees as  seen by both Rudhyar and the Hills.  In the passages taken from Rudhyar, I have eliminated only those phrases relating to his "sequence stages" which he had suggested for the degrees, and one reference to the Great Polar Cycle.  Other than that, his impressions are presented basically unchanged.  In regards to the work I have taken from the Hills, the passages come from the web page postings and appear here in italics.  I leave it to the reader to compose his or her own "feeling tone" for the Harmonic Concordance moment.

The Sun:  16° 13" Scorpio

The Image:

A woman, fecundated by her own Spirit, is "Great with Child." (Rudhyar)
A woman, filled with her own spirit, is the father of her own child. (Hill)

Keynote:

A total reliance upon the dictates of the God-within.

Commentary:

 

...here we see the result of a deep and complete concentration reaching to the innermost center of the personality where the Living God acts as a fecundating power.  This reveals the potency of the inward way, the surrender of the ego to a transcendent force, which can create through the person vivid manifestations of the Will of God.
...the realization of the normally hidden potentialities in the average human being of our day.  Faith in the Divine is shown here being concretely justified.  The human person becomes a "mother of the Living God."  This is the transpersonal way of existence.  It is the way that leads to creative mutations. (Rudhyar)

You may feel that you need to be totally self-sufficient at the moment.  You don't require assistance for even the most complicated tasks.  Bear in mind that we are all blessed with our individual qualities and it is the combination with other individuals that creates greater balance and depth.  The immaculate conception.  (Hill) 

Jupiter:  14° 21" Virgo

The Image:

A fine lace handkerchief, heirloom from valorous ancestors.  
A fine lace ornamental handkerchief.

 Keynote:

The quintessence of deeds well done.

Commentary:

Root strength produces beautiful flowers.  The neophyte who acts with determination, courage and discrimination while following "in the footsteps" of his predecessors receives a symbolic prize from the Brotherhood ready to welcome him when he has fully proven himself on the battlefield where he meets his past, which tries to block his way.  The mystic beloved hands him what she has woven for him out of spiritual thread.
…This scene begins with the revelation in a portrait of salient features in a man’s face.  It ends with symbols which bring out the ultimate validity of the many efforts of generations of men towards the building of a beautiful and significant culture. The Man of Culture is, in the deepest and best sense of the term, the aristocrat.  He is the flowering of a line of ancestors who have accepted responsibility for a group or community.  Likewise,  the true "disciple" is the blossom that crowns a long series of incarnations. 

Sometimes the smallest tokens of our past can bring us a sense of security and joy.   The scent of the "fabric," the care and loving that have gone into the crafting give us a sense of security and being loved.  Delicacy of feeling and attention to detail. 

Saturn: 13° 03" Cancer

The Image:

A very old man facing a vast dark space to the Northeast. 
A very old man, facing a vast dark space to the northeast.

Keynote:

Fulfillment in transcending and changeless wisdom.

Commentary:

This symbol describes the Wise Old Man, an archetypal figure found in all systems of symbolism.  In occult terminology, the northeast is the direction from which spiritual-cosmic forces enter the Earth-sphere.  This is probably because the polar axis of the Earth is inclined by some 23° away from the exact perpendicular to the plane of its orbit…This is the (traditionally) spiritual state.  The Wise Old Man faces the Changeless Reality, the true North – which for us is located in a northeast direction.  He faces the great Void, that apparent Darkness which is an intense Light invisible to our senses.
…Implied is that by consistently and for a long time meditating on the changeless and spiritual reality at the very core of all experiences one can attain the supreme age-old wisdom.  We see in the symbol a way beyond appearances and toward permanence in truth. 


You may be looking for some help or spiritual guidance, but it may be difficult to  find through the usual channels.  As we become more enlightened there is a greater ability to see spiritual truth. There needs to be a trust and courage that your inner wisdom is in touch with the higher truth.  This is the degree of Sirius.  

The Moon: 16° 13" Taurus

The Image:

A symbolical battle between "swords" and "torches."  
A symbolical battle between "swords" and "torches."

Keynote:

Refusing to depend upon the past, the seeker turns warrior, fighting anew the eternal "Great War."

Commentary:

When Gautama, having sought in vain for the answers to his questions among teachers of tradition, sat under the Bodhi Tree, he had to fight his own battle in his own way, even though it is an eternal fight.  The spiritual light within the greater Soul must struggle against the ego-will that only knows how to use the powers of this material and intellectual world.  There is no possibility of escape: it is the energy that arises out of the present moment – the inescapable NOW – that the daring individual has to use in the struggle.
This…symbol suggests that salvation is attained through the emergent individual’s readiness to face all issues as if there were only two opposed sides.  So teaches the Bhagavada-Gita.  This is the dharma of this stage of evolution: a stage of Polarization of values.
 

At the moment there is a struggle between practical needs and the underlying reasons for having those needs.  You may find that you have become caught up in what you are trying to achieve and have lost sight of why.   The endeavour to bring "enlightenment" to people often meets with severe resistance. Witness the stranglehold the media has on information. Arguments over ideals. "Might" versus "light."    

Mars: 10° 35" Pisces

The Image:

Men traveling a narrow path, seeking illumination.  
Men traveling a narrow path, seeking illumination.

 Keynote:

The capacity inherent in every individual to seek, at whatever cost, entrance to a transcendent realm of reality.

Commentary:

This refers to the ancient and eternal symbol of the Path of Discipleship. The greatness of man is that he can always be greater; and the belief – deeply rooted in man’s inner nature – that if he fulfills the necessary conditions he can find "Elder Brothers" who have already attained a higher level of consciousness and will transfer their attainment and light to him. The path is always open to the pure in heart, the mentally aware, the conqueror of emotions and the spiritually self-mobilized.
This symbol opens…a new level of consciousness.  Man is always in the making and remaking.  He can always go further, reach beyond.  But he has to take the first step.  Someone can show him the Path, but he alone can do the walking.  Thus the Zen injunction: WALK ON. 


Sometimes the search for high ideals and understandings place us at odds with conservative social expectations.  It is the ability to persevere with the search, regardless of the cost, that marks the sincerity of a journey.   Most times this quest is very illuminating, although sometimes confusing. You will need to reject that which is unworthy.  People "on the path."  

Chiron: 14° 06" Capricorn

The Image:

In a hospital, the children’s ward is filled with toys.  
In a hospital, the children’s ward is filled with toys.

Keynote:

The responsibility of society to ensure the welfare and total health of the new generation. 

Commentary:

The sociocultural process must look to the future as well as to the past.  It has created conditions which may harm the children who will carry forward its work, and must try to repair these negative conditions through love as well as through physical care.  In personal life, the individual should take great care of his fresh institutions and his dreams of future growth.  They are often fragile developments which the pressures of everyday life can easily distort or destroy.
…There is therefore constant need for TENDER CARE as well as skill to neutralize the destructive tensions of social living.


In times of healing there is a need for simple pleasures to raise the spirit.   You may find that there is a need for these caring shows of affectionate concern.  Bringing simple gifts to the sick or disadvantaged.  Looking after one's responsibilities.  Nurturing those of younger years or the lesser evolved. 

And finally,

The Part of Fortune: 13° 13"  Capricorn

(Although not a planet, Fortuna certainly has a significant message in this chart, since it will be fixed in position at the exact cusp of the 7th house, no matter where on Earth you will be at the Concordance moment.)  

The Image:

An ancient bas-relief carved in granite remains a witness to a long-forgotten culture.

An ancient bas-relief carved in granite remains a witness to a long-forgotten culture.  

Keynote: The will to unearth, in our culture as well as in any culture, what has permanent value, and to let go of nonessentials.
Commentary: At a time when in nearly every land men are questioning the validity of traditional beliefs...We must strive to free these ideals from the wild growth of personal and class selfishness... and learn to appreciate the excellence of... the immortal seed-foundation, as well as the spiritual harvest, of any culture...

The issue you may find in your situation is not so much in superficial display, but in the longevity and stability of the foundation or backdrop of your society. Some things never fade, they stand as reminders of ancient eras, bringing messages from the past. Anonymous immortality. Things carved in stone, or concrete. Permanent records. If negative - limitations by not allowing for changes. Is this situation old and outworn?

It is interesting to note the qualities of the specific planetary energies that are associated with each of the degrees.  Notice, for example: the forward thrust implied for the degree of Mars; the reaching-across-from-future-to-past quality that is assigned to Chiron’s degree; the reference to the Spirit-life-within given for the Moon; the Wise Old Man who stands at Saturn’s degree; the aristocratic man of culture who greets Jupiter; and finally the creative God-within that is the Sun.  Each degree fits as snuggly on the chart as does a babe into the arms of Mother which, come to think of it, is who and where we are.  

Taken all around, the Sabian Symbols provide what I see as a "feeing tone" that strikes just the right note for The Harmonic Concordance.
